Is there a points system for bookings at Sheraton Vacation Club?
Sheraton Vacation Club operates under a points-based system that allows members to use their points to book vacations at various locations within the club's portfolio. Members are assigned a certain number of points each year, which they can use to reserve accommodations at Sheraton Vacation Club resorts. The number of points required for a specific booking can vary depending on factors such as the type of accommodation, the season, and the length of stay.
During peak travel seasons, the point requirements for bookings may be higher, while off-peak periods may offer more favorable point rates. Members have the flexibility to use their points in several ways, allowing for a variety of vacation options, including the ability to stay at different resorts, change the length of stay, or even combine points for larger accommodations if available.
Members are encouraged to plan their vacations in advance to ensure availability and to get the most value out of their points. It is advisable for individuals to review the specific details regarding point values and booking requirements on the official Sheraton Vacation Club website, as this information can sometimes be updated or changed.
